Can’t download or send media files. If you’re experiencing issues downloading or sending photos, videos, or voice messages, check the following: Your phone has an active internet connection with a strong signal. Try loading a webpage to make sure. Your phone's date and time are set correctly. If your date is incorrect, you won't be able to.

Well, one way or the other, the internet connectivity of your device is usually the cause behind your WhatsApp not downloading images. 2. Phone's date and time are set incorrectly. The next thing to look at when you are not being able to download images on WhatsApp is - your phone’s date and time. This is because, when the date is incorrect you may not be able to connect with WhatsApp servers to get the message or download the media. To re-adjust the date and time on your phone, go to Settings System Date time and set your date and time to Automatic. If you're unable to install WhatsApp due to insufficient space on your phone, try to clear Google Play Store's cache and data: Go to your phone's Settings, then tap Apps notifications App info Google Play Store Storage CLEAR CACHE. Tap CLEAR DATA OK. Restart your phone, then try installing WhatsApp again.
